nvme_find_rq() resolves a device-supplied command id to a request with
blk_mq_tag_to_rq(), which returns whatever request last used that tag -
possibly one that is no longer in flight (freed, or never dispatched and
thus with a NULL rq->mq_hctx). Commit e7006de6c238 ("nvme: code
command_id with a genctr for use-after-free validation") guards against
this, but its generation counter is only 4 bits wide and can be matched
by a malfunctioning or malicious device replaying command ids. The
driver then completes a request that is not outstanding, dereferencing a
NULL rq->mq_hctx or double-completing a command:
Oops: general protection fault ... KASAN: null-ptr-deref
RIP: blk_mq_complete_request_remote+0xe5/0xa80 block/blk-mq.c:1319
nvme_handle_cqe drivers/nvme/host/pci.c:1418 [inline]
nvme_poll_cq drivers/nvme/host/pci.c:1449
nvme_irq drivers/nvme/host/pci.c:1463
Require the request to be in flight before completing it. The check uses
the request state, so it also covers controllers with
NVME_QUIRK_SKIP_CID_GEN.
Found by FuzzNvme(Syzkaller with FEMU fuzzing framework).

The commit message covers the freed / never-dispatched case (the NULL rq->mq_hctx dereference). When the stale command id instead maps to a tag that has already been *reused*, the driver completes an unrelated, still-in-flight request -- a use-after-free. Under fuzzing (a device that replays and reorders completions) this did not show up as a clean NULL deref but as cross-subsystem memory corruption: general protection faults in mtree_range_walk(), unlink_anon_vmas() and the slub freelist, in unrelated tasks (modprobe, systemd-udevd, ...). The trigger was a stale completion delivered for a request that a concurrent controller reset had just freed. To confirm the fix addresses this, I rebuilt the kernel with the patch and re-ran the same workload for ~10h. The guard now rejects the offending completion instead of acting on it: nvme nvme0: resetting controller nvme nvme0: completion for request 0x1c0 not in flight nvme nvme0: invalid id 448 completed on queue 2 and no use-after-free / corruption recurred over the run. The code is unchanged; I'm happy to fold this into the commit message as a v2 if you'd prefer it spelled out there.
